# Industrial Park Ground Stabilization Using Geocell in Hosur, Tamil Nadu

## **Introduction**

Industrial parks require robust ground stabilization systems capable of supporting heavy vehicle traffic, industrial equipment, and infrastructure loads. Weak or unstable soils can lead to settlement, pavement cracking, and costly repairs if not addressed during the construction phase.

To overcome these challenges, engineers increasingly rely on geosynthetic solutions such as [geocells](https://oceangeosynthetics.com/products/geocells/), which provide efficient soil confinement and load distribution.

This case study examines the use of **Ocean HDPE Geocell 356×100 MM** in an **Industrial Park Project in Hosur, Tamil Nadu**, where geocell reinforcement was deployed to enhance soil stability and improve pavement performance.

## Table of Contents

## **Project Overview**

Project Name: Industrial Park Project

Location: Hosur, Tamil Nadu

Product Supplied: Ocean HDPE Geocell 356×100 MM

Quantity Used: 5,006 SQM

The geocell system was installed to reinforce the subgrade and create a stable base capable of supporting heavy industrial traffic.

## **Role of Geocells in Infrastructure Projects**

Geocells are three-dimensional honeycomb structures made from HDPE strips that confine soil or aggregate materials. When filled with soil or stone, the system distributes loads over a wider area, reducing stress on the underlying soil.

Geocells are commonly used for:

- Road construction
- Industrial yards
- Slope stabilization
- Railway embankments
- Channel protection

Research by the **Federal Highway Administration (FHWA)** shows that geocell reinforcement can increase soil bearing capacity by up to **40–50 percent**, making it particularly effective for infrastructure built on weak subgrades.

## **Installation Challenges and Quality Control**

Installing geocells requires careful planning and execution.

Key steps include:

- Subgrade preparation and compaction
- Expansion and anchoring of the geocell panels
- Filling with aggregate or soil material

Quality control measures include verifying cell expansion, ensuring uniform filling, and maintaining proper compaction levels.

Failure to properly anchor the system can lead to displacement during loading.
